There is not a direct bus from Orland, CA to Big Spring, TX. There is not a bus stop in Orland, CA, but there is one in Big Spring, TX.

The closest bus stop from Orland, CA is in Chico, CA, which is around 17 miles away.

There may be a bus schedule from Chico, CA to Big Spring, TX.

The population of Orland, CA is 7,843

Orland, CA is in Glenn county.

Big Spring, TX is in Howard county.
